Release checklist — Brindlemere Queue 7.1. Verify log compaction completes on the staging cluster before sign-off. Compaction must reclaim at least 60% of segment space on the Torvane partitions; anything less means the tombstone sweep stalled. Check compactor lag metrics, confirm no consumer offsets regress, and run the Halloway replay test twice. If compaction hangs, restart only the compactor pod, never the broker. Record results in the release doc. The verification build token follows.

session token of bawep-yadup = htk21_528abd376e3c5a4ec24a1

## Ticket: Sig check failing on alert fan-out

For the eng sync: Stormfeed's fan-out workers started rejecting payloads from the Brindle relay last night — signature mismatch on every batch, so no county alerts went out for ~40 minutes. Looks like the relay rotated keys without telling us. Workers need updating with the new verification key, which is below.

rollout seal: bky13_zMSdroAXJPwnP

## Key Ceremony Checklist — Item 7: Config Hot-Reload

Before sealing, confirm your plugin tolerates a live config reload from the Brasskey host. Trigger the reload signal, verify no dropped connections, and record the result in the ceremony log. If the reload daemon reports a locked keystore, recover it at the console by entering the passphrase noted directly below.

strongbox words: sorir-belvan-rusix-ulays-ralmir-praix-eliir-tamax-praael-druael-julir-tamius-jorir

## Service Accounts — StormFan Alert Fan-Out

The fan-out worker authenticates to the internal dispatch tier using the svc-stormfan account. Rotate quarterly; scopes are limited to publish-only on alert topics. If deliveries stall during your shift, verify the worker is using the current credential, reproduced below for reference.

API key for kaweg-hahif: kto4_rAjZ

### Spoolhaven Recovery — On-Call Notes

If the printer-spooler microservice locks you out mid-incident (happens more than we'd like), don't panic. Restart attempts won't help once the service account is wedged. Instead, hit the recovery endpoint on the admin port and it'll ask for the team recovery passphrase. Grab a coffee first — the prompt times out slowly. The passphrase you'll need is right here.

unlock words, bagag-kajef: zormir-jorath-tammir-oliius-briix-norys